Transaction cd73d40d74d33faefb657271ec71c5d6a851a16e82572eaa8ae49f85b2736fb8
2 Input
2 Outputs
- cd73d40d74d33faefb657271ec71c5d6a851a16e82572eaa8ae49f85b2736fb8:0
- cd73d40d74d33faefb657271ec71c5d6a851a16e82572eaa8ae49f85b2736fb8:1
value 27446871
address 3CYXpbe3cM1vktcRN4BL87wi5J1gTtaJuB
value 23709253
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n